当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

华为云 mysql,华为云ECS服务器安装MySQL,从入门到实战

华为云 mysql,华为云ECS服务器安装MySQL,从入门到实战

华为云MySQL教程,涵盖从入门到实战,指导用户如何在华为云ECS服务器上安装和配置MySQL,包括基础知识、安装步骤和实际操作案例。...

华为云MySQL教程,涵盖从入门到实战,指导用户如何在华为云ECS服务器上安装和配置MySQL,包括基础知识、安装步骤和实际操作案例。

随着互联网的快速发展,数据库在各个领域都扮演着至关重要的角色,MySQL作为一款开源的、高性能的关系型数据库,广泛应用于各种场景,本文将详细介绍如何在华为云ECS服务器上安装MySQL,帮助您快速入门并实战。

准备工作

1、准备一台华为云ECS服务器,并确保已开通公网访问权限。

2、在ECS服务器上安装并配置好SSH客户端,PuTTY(Windows)、Xshell(Windows)、SecureCRT(Windows)等。

华为云 mysql,华为云ECS服务器安装MySQL,从入门到实战

3、确保ECS服务器的操作系统为Linux(如CentOS、Ubuntu等)。

4、准备MySQL安装包,根据您的操作系统选择相应的版本。

安装MySQL

1、下载MySQL安装包

(1)访问MySQL官方网站:https://dev.mysql.com/downloads/mysql/

(2)选择适合您的操作系统和版本,下载安装包。

2、解压安装包

(1)登录ECS服务器,使用SSH客户端连接。

(2)使用cd命令切换到下载目录,cd /path/to/download/directory

(3)使用tar -zxvf mysql-5.7.26-linux-glibc2.12-x86_64.tar.gz命令解压安装包。

3、创建MySQL用户和用户组

(1)使用groupadd命令创建MySQL用户组:groupadd mysql

(2)使用useradd命令创建MySQL用户:useradd -r -g mysql -s /sbin/nologin mysql

4、设置MySQL安装目录

(1)创建MySQL安装目录:mkdir -p /usr/local/mysql

(2)将解压后的MySQL文件移动到安装目录:mv mysql-5.7.26-linux-glibc2.12-x86_64 /usr/local/mysql

5、修改MySQL安装目录权限

(1)进入MySQL安装目录:cd /usr/local/mysql

(2)修改安装目录权限:chown -R root:root ./

6、配置MySQL

(1)进入MySQL安装目录的bin目录:cd /usr/local/mysql/bin

(2)运行mysqld_safe --user=mysql命令启动MySQL服务。

(3)查看MySQL进程,确保服务已启动:ps -ef | grep mysql

华为云 mysql,华为云ECS服务器安装MySQL,从入门到实战

(4)运行mysql命令进入MySQL命令行界面:mysql -u root -p

(5)修改root用户的密码:set password = password('new_password');

(6)退出MySQL命令行界面:quit

7、创建MySQL配置文件

(1)创建MySQL配置文件:vi /etc/my.cnf

(2)添加以下内容:

[mysqld]

basedir=/usr/local/mysql

datadir=/usr/local/mysql/data

socket=/usr/local/mysql/mysql.sock

port=3306

max_connections=100

character_set_server=utf8mb4

collation_server=utf8mb4_unicode_ci

skip-character-set-client-handshake

8、重新启动MySQL服务

(1)停止MySQL服务:mysqladmin -u root -p shutdown

(2)启动MySQL服务:mysqld_safe --user=mysql

9、创建MySQL用户和数据库

(1)进入MySQL命令行界面:mysql -u root -p

(2)创建用户:C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';

(3)授权用户:GRANT ALL PRIVILEGES ON *.* TO 'username'@'localhost' WITH GRANT OPTION;

华为云 mysql,华为云ECS服务器安装MySQL,从入门到实战

(4)刷新权限:FLUSH PRIVILEGES;

(5)退出MySQL命令行界面:quit

实战:连接MySQL数据库

1、使用MySQL客户端连接MySQL数据库

(1)打开MySQL客户端,navicat、phpMyAdmin等。

(2)填写以下信息:

- 主机:ECS服务器的公网IP地址

- 端口:3306

- 用户名:username

- 密码:password

(3)点击“连接”,即可连接到MySQL数据库。

2、在MySQL客户端执行SQL语句,

(1)创建数据库:CREATE DATABASE test;

(2)创建表:CREATE TABLE users (

id INT PRIMARY KEY AUTO_INCREMENT,

username VARCHAR(50),

password VARCHAR(50)

);

(3)插入数据:INSERT INTO users (username, password) VALUES ('admin', 'admin123');

(4)查询数据:SELECT * FROM users;

本文详细介绍了在华为云ECS服务器上安装MySQL的过程,包括准备工作、安装MySQL、配置MySQL、创建用户和数据库、连接MySQL数据库等,通过本文的学习,您应该能够熟练地在华为云ECS服务器上安装和配置MySQL,为后续的数据库应用打下坚实基础。

黑狐家游戏

发表评论

最新文章